Jacksonboro was founded in the 1730s, and named after john jackson, the original owner of the town site. South carolina books, stories, novels for sale online. Jacksonboro is an unincorporated community and censusdesignated place located in southeastern colleton county, south carolina, united states, along the west side of the edisto river. Revolutionary war martyr isaac hayne inherited this property in colleton county from his father, also named isaac hayne, in 1751. It was located on parkers ferry road, the busy stagecoach thoroughfare that connected charleston, south carolina and savannah, georgia. Its name was changed to jacksonborough after july of 1869, and back again to jacksonboro on november 28, 1892. The south carolina gazette was published in the spring of 1782 at parkers ferry, a few miles above jacksonboro, being the first publication outside charlestown.
